擅长:python、mysql、java
<p>这就是分位数的定义</p>
<pre><code>df = pd.DataFrame(np.array([60,70,80,100,130,150,200,200,250,300,800,1000]))
print df.quantile(.25)
print df.quantile(.50)
print df.quantile(.75)
</code></pre>
<p>(数据集的q1是95 btw)</p>
<p>中位数在150到200(175)之间</p>
<p>第一个分位数是80到100之间的四分之三(95)</p>
<p>第三个分位数是250到300之间的四分之一(262.5)</p>